As we age, our body slows its production of collagen and other skin components that give our skin a youthful look. Patients looking to slow the signs of aging can add definition and contour with natural-looking skin fillers.

Fillers are gel compounds Dr. Schroeder will inject into your skin. Some compounds can help hydrate the skin internally, while others may encourage collagen production. The filler used will depend on your goals, but they are all designed to get natural-looking results using effective FDA-approved materials.
